[Morgan Stanley Analyzes NVIDIA's New Cloud Revenue Sharing Model, Optimistic About $10 Billion in Recurring Revenue] According to TrendForce Research, Morgan Stanley's August 14 report highlighted that NVIDIA has introduced a new cloud architecture, offering credit guarantees to new cloud service providers in exchange for future cloud revenue sharing. Morgan Stanley maintains an Overweight rating for NVIDIA with a target price of $288, believing this model could generate recurring revenue in the range of $10 billion. Morgan Stanley estimates that if the new cloud ecosystem reaches a scale of 25GW, with annual revenue of $20 million per MW, and NVIDIA secures one-quarter of the revenue share, FY28 EBIT could increase by approximately 60%. NVIDIA's announced $500 billion investment fund has already limited its direct exposure to below 25%.
